SEDIBA,
a Sotho word for "source of the
spring" - Just three hours from
Johannesburg and four hours from Durban and an
ideal stop-over from the Cape. This beautiful
game farm nestles in the foothills of the
majestic Maluti Mountains, situated just 10
kilometers from the picturesque little town of
Clarens.

Sediba consists
of South Lodge (twin beds, sleeps 6) three
bedrooms each with en-suite bathroom, lounge,
dining area and kitchen. North Lodge consists of
two bedrooms (twin beds, sleeps 4) Both Lodges
have open fireplaces, heated towel rails,
electric 'all night' blankets, "Weber braais" and covered patios.
The lodges are spacious, well appointed, fully
serviced and offer home from home comfort. The
view from all the windows and doors is stunning
and both Lodges are within a few metres of a
well stocked trout dam. The 'Rooiberge' mountain
range and sandstone cliffs offer a breathtaking
backdrop.

| The third Lodge, "Sediba Mountain Lodge" is appointed
in the same up-market design and overlooks the
trout dam and game park. This luxurious lodge
commands superlative views, sleeps 4 in two
separate spacious bedrooms (twin beds in one and
kingsize bed in the other) They have en-suite
bathrooms, underfloor heating, kitchen,
diningroom and lounge, and a large open
fireplace. |

If you can tear yourself away from Sediba,
Clarens and Golden Gate have much to offer the
visitor. Clarens has a profusion of Art
Galleries and craft shops, and good restaurants.
If its excitement you are looking for then try
the white river rafting, or 4x4 quad biking.
Take a more leisurely drive through Golden Gate
National Park or go on a dinosaur walk, or visit
historical Boer War sites. There is a golf
course, horseriding, bushmen paintings, squash
and tennis courts available. Clarens is a
beautiful little town, with much to see and do.

DIRECTIONS TO
GET TO SEDIBA LODGE FROM GAUTENG
(Recommended from the Sandton & East side of
Johannesburg. )
1. Take the N3 from Johannesburg to Durban.
2. As you cross the Vaal River at Villiers, before the
Toll Gate, turn off the N3 and follow the R26 to
Frankfort.
3. Continue with the R26 until you get to a T-Junction.
4. TURN TO YOUR RIGHT towards Frankfort.
5. Pass the town of Frankfort and cross a bridge over a
large river.
6. Veer towards the left still on the R 26 towards
Tweeling.
7. Continue straight on with this road, the R26, over a
stop street and past Reitz.
8. When you get to Bethlehem carry on through the
traffic lights, then a four way stop, and then through a
second set of traffic lights, and past a large Engen
Garage on your right.
9. About 6 km’s from Bethlehem turn onto the R711 to
Golden Gate & Clarens. You are about 25 km’s from
Clarens.
10. You will pass through the Noupoort or “Nek” of
Clarens. Continue down the hill until you see the road
leading to Fouriesburg on your right (R711). Turn right
here and continue for 10 km’s where you will find 2
white pillars on the left hand side of the road.
11. Turn into the driveway, follow the signs to Sediba
or Mountain Lodge.
DIRECTIONS TO GET TO SEDIBA LODGE FROM GAUTENG
(Recommended from the West side of Johannesburg. )
1. Take the main road to the Free State and after the
Grassmere Toll Plaza follow the Heilbron signs.
2. Turn left into Heilbron and continue straight through
the town.
3. Continue on past Paul Roux.
4. Continue straight on with this road, until you meet
the R26 at the cross roads near Reitz.
5. Turn right towards Bethlehem.
6. When you get to Bethlehem carry on through the
traffic lights, then a four way stop, and then through a
another set of traffic lights, and past a large Engen
Garage on your right.
7. About 6 km’s from Bethlehem turn right onto the
R711 / R712 to Golden Gate & Clarens. You are about
25 km’s from Clarens.
8. You will pass through the Noupoort or “Nek” of
Clarens. Continue down the hill until you see the road
leading to Fouriesburg on your right (R711). Turn right
here and continue for 10 km’s where you will find 2
white pillars on the left hand side of the road.
9. Turn into the driveway, follow the signs to Sediba or
Mountain Lodge.
DIRECTIONS TO GET TO CLARENS FROM BLOEMFONTEIN
1. Take the Thabanchu road via Ladybrand, Ficksburg and
Fouriesburg.
2. Turn right onto the R711 at Fouriesburg to Clarens.
3. Travel for 24 km’s. Shortly after the Surrender
Hill sign you will see 2 white pillars on the right hand
side of the road..
4. Turn into the driveway, follow the signs to Sediba or
Mountain Lodge.
DIRECTIONS TO SEDIBA FROM KWA ZULU NATAL
1. Turn off the N3 at the Winterton Central Berg turn
off just after the Estcourt Ultra City.
2. Continue through Winterton and Bergville up the
Oliviershoek Pass.
3. After passing the Sterkfontein Dam turn left at the
T-Junction towards Qwa-Qwa.
4. Continue straight on this road towards Golden Gate
National Park. (Beware the Speed Humps in the park!!)
5. You will pass the entrance of the CLARENS GOLF CLUB.
Continue down the hill until you see the road leading to
Fouriesburg on your left (R711). Turn left here and
continue for 10 km’s where you will find 2 white
pillars on the left hand side of the road.
9. Turn into the driveway, follow the signs to Sediba or
Mountain Lodge. |
